What Unique Factors Should You Consider When Choosing Carpet for a Florida Home?
When choosing carpet for a Florida home, several unique factors should be considered due to the state’s climate and lifestyle.
- Moisture Resistance: Florida’s humid climate can lead to mold and mildew growth in carpets. Selecting carpets made from synthetic fibers, such as nylon or polypropylene, can help resist moisture and prevent these issues.
- UV Stability: The intense Florida sun can fade carpets over time, especially those with vibrant colors. Look for carpets that are UV-stabilized or have built-in fade resistance to maintain their appearance longer.
- Low Pile Height: Low pile carpets are ideal in Florida as they are easier to clean and maintain, especially in sandy environments. They also allow for better airflow and drying, reducing the risk of mold growth.
- Stain Resistance: Given the outdoor lifestyle and potential spills from beach and pool activities, choosing carpets with stain-resistant treatments can be beneficial. These treatments make it easier to clean up accidents and keep carpets looking fresh.
- Comfort and Insulation: While Florida is warm, having a comfortable carpet can enhance the coziness of a home. Consider carpets that provide a good balance of softness underfoot while still allowing for air circulation to keep the home comfortable.
- Easy Maintenance: Opt for carpets that are easy to clean, as high humidity can lead to dirt and grime accumulation. Carpets with a short pile and stain-resistant properties will facilitate quicker and more efficient cleaning.

What Carpet Materials Are Most Suitable for Hot and Humid Climates?
The best carpet materials for hot and humid climates prioritize moisture resistance, durability, and breathability.
- Nylon: Nylon carpets are known for their resilience and durability, making them suitable for high-traffic areas. They are also resistant to stains and moisture, which helps prevent mold and mildew growth, a critical factor in humid environments.
- Polypropylene (Olefin): Polypropylene is highly resistant to moisture and mold, making it an excellent choice for humid climates. This material is also lightweight, affordable, and available in various colors, which makes it versatile for homeowners looking to enhance their decor.
- Berber Carpet: Berber carpets are typically made from looped fibers, which allow for better airflow and help to keep the carpet cool. Their dense weave makes them durable and resistant to wear, making them a great option for homes in Florida.
- SmartStrand (Triexta): This innovative material is made from renewable resources and is exceptionally resistant to stains and moisture. SmartStrand carpets are soft underfoot and come with built-in protection against odors and allergens, making them ideal for humid climates.
- Carpet Tiles: Carpet tiles provide flexibility and ease of maintenance, as they can be easily replaced if damaged. They are often made from moisture-resistant materials, making them suitable for humid environments, and their modular nature allows for creative designs and patterns.
Which Carpet Fibers Offer the Best Performance for Florida Homes?
The best carpet fibers for Florida homes consider moisture resistance and durability due to the state’s humid climate.
- Nylon: Nylon is a highly durable and resilient fiber, making it an excellent choice for high-traffic areas in Florida homes. It is also stain-resistant and holds its shape well, even with heavy use, which is ideal for families and pets.
- Polyester: Polyester is known for its softness and vibrant color options, which can enhance the aesthetics of a Florida home. It is also naturally moisture-resistant, helping to prevent mildew and mold, making it suitable for the humid environment.
- Olefin (Polypropylene): Olefin is a cost-effective option that offers excellent moisture resistance and is easy to clean. Its ability to resist fading from sunlight makes it particularly appealing for homes in sunny Florida areas.
- Wool: Wool is a natural fiber that provides exceptional comfort and durability, as well as natural resistance to stains. However, it requires more maintenance and is less resistant to moisture compared to synthetic options, so it may not be the best choice for very humid conditions.
- Triexta: Triexta is a newer fiber that combines the softness of polyester with the durability of nylon. It is highly stain-resistant and has built-in moisture resistance, making it suitable for Florida climates while providing a luxurious feel underfoot.
Why is Nylon Considered a Durable Option for Florida Carpets?
Nylon is considered a durable option for Florida carpets primarily due to its exceptional resilience and moisture resistance, which are crucial for withstanding the humid climate of the region.
According to the Carpet and Rug Institute, nylon fibers are known for their strength and ability to retain their appearance over time, making them ideal for high-traffic areas commonly found in homes. This durability is further enhanced by the fiber’s resistance to wear and tear, which is especially important in Florida where sandy and wet conditions can lead to quicker degradation of other materials.
The underlying mechanism that contributes to nylon’s durability lies in its chemical structure; nylon is a synthetic polymer that has been engineered to be both flexible and robust. This allows the fibers to withstand the stress of foot traffic without fraying or becoming matted. Additionally, nylon carpets can be treated to repel moisture and stains, making them less susceptible to mold and mildew, which are prevalent in Florida’s humid environment. This combination of properties results in a carpet that not only lasts longer but also maintains its aesthetic appeal in the face of challenging conditions.

What Styles of Carpet Are Best for Florida’s Lifestyle and Environment?
The best carpet styles for Florida’s lifestyle and environment are designed to withstand humidity, resist mold, and provide comfort in warm temperatures.
- Indoor-Outdoor Carpet: This style is made from synthetic fibers that are resistant to moisture and UV rays, making it ideal for humid conditions. It can be easily cleaned and is durable enough to handle heavy foot traffic, making it suitable for patios and sunrooms.
- Berber Carpet: Known for its looped construction, Berber carpet is highly durable and resistant to wear, making it perfect for homes with pets and children. Its low pile also helps to prevent moisture retention, which is essential in Florida’s humid climate.
- Frieze Carpet: This style features twisted fibers that create a shag-like appearance, offering a soft and cozy feel underfoot. Frieze carpets are resilient and tend to hide dirt and stains well, making them a practical choice for busy households in Florida.
- Solution-Dyed Nylon Carpet: This type of carpet is dyed during the manufacturing process, making it highly resistant to fading and staining. Its synthetic composition also allows it to endure the high humidity and heat typical of Florida, ensuring longevity and a vibrant appearance.
- Low-Pile Carpet: Low-pile carpets have shorter fibers that allow for better air circulation, reducing moisture retention and the potential for mold growth. They are easier to clean and maintain, making them an excellent option for Florida homes where spills and humidity are common.

What Essential Maintenance Practices Can Prolong Carpet Life in Florida?
Essential maintenance practices can significantly extend the life of carpets in Florida homes due to the unique climate conditions.
- Regular Vacuuming: Frequent vacuuming helps to remove dirt, dust, and allergens that can accumulate in the fibers. In Florida, where humidity can contribute to mold growth, keeping carpets clean is crucial for maintaining both appearance and hygiene.
- Professional Cleaning: Scheduling professional carpet cleaning at least once a year can help deep clean the fibers and remove stubborn stains. Professionals use specialized equipment and solutions that can extract dirt and moisture more effectively than home methods, which is particularly beneficial in humid environments.
- Moisture Management: Utilizing dehumidifiers and ensuring proper ventilation can help control moisture levels in a home, reducing the risk of mold and mildew. This is especially important in Florida’s humid climate, where excess moisture can easily damage carpets and lead to unpleasant odors.
- Immediate Spill Treatment: Addressing spills immediately can prevent stains from setting and fibers from being damaged. Using a clean, dry cloth to blot spills gently, followed by appropriate cleaning solutions designed for carpets, can help maintain the carpet’s integrity and appearance.
- Area Rugs and Mats: Placing area rugs and mats in high-traffic areas can protect your carpets from wear and tear. This is particularly useful in Florida where sandy feet and wet conditions can quickly soil carpets, so having protective layers can significantly reduce maintenance needs.
- Rotation and Rearrangement: Periodically rotating furniture and rearranging room layouts can prevent uneven wear patterns on carpets. This practice allows for even exposure to foot traffic and sunlight, helping to maintain the carpet’s color and texture over time.
- Choosing the Right Carpet: Selecting carpets made from moisture-resistant materials can be beneficial in Florida’s climate. Options like nylon or polyester, which are durable and resist fading, can provide better longevity in homes exposed to humidity and sunlight.
How Can Humidity Control Measures Benefit Carpet Longevity?
Humidity control measures can significantly enhance the longevity of carpets, especially in climates like Florida where humidity levels can be high.
- Dehumidifiers: Using dehumidifiers helps reduce excess moisture in the air, which can prevent mold and mildew growth in carpets. These appliances maintain a balanced indoor humidity level, thereby protecting the carpet fibers and backing from degradation caused by excess moisture.
- Air Conditioning: Proper air conditioning not only cools the home but also helps regulate humidity levels. By keeping the indoor environment at a comfortable temperature and humidity level, air conditioning reduces the risk of carpet damage due to moisture accumulation.
- Ventilation: Good ventilation systems allow for the circulation of fresh air while removing stale, humid air. This constant airflow helps to keep carpets dry and prevents the buildup of moisture, which can lead to unpleasant odors and deterioration of carpet materials.
- Moisture Barriers: Installing moisture barriers underneath carpets can prevent ground moisture from seeping into the carpet. These barriers help to isolate the carpet from moisture sources, extending its life and maintaining its appearance.
- Regular Maintenance: Routine cleaning and maintenance, including steam cleaning and professional carpet care, can help remove trapped moisture and dirt. This practice not only enhances the carpet’s appearance but also mitigates the risk of mold and mildew, promoting a longer lifespan.
